Summary:
One little girl wakes up to a wondrous fairy-tale world. She spies
two dancing feet from the Golden Goose tale, three hungry bears just
visited by Goldilocks, and four royal mattresses between the Princess
and the Pea. Simple in format, with many objects to count on each
colorful page, 1 2 3 is just right for children learning their
numbers 1 through 10. As in her ABC and Picture This . . ., acclaimed
as Âbeautiful, Âinventive, and Âmarvelous, Alison Jay
captivates with this clever work of art, treating readers of all ages
to visual surprises, scenes from ten favorite fairy tales, and witty
stories-within-stories.
